Guia de instalação do Battle.net para Linux, SteamOS e Steam Deck para jogar World of Warcraft e Starcraft

O mundo dos jogos Linux, embora tradicionalmente marginalizado por alguns desenvolvedores, está ganhando relevância e acessibilidade para jogadores apaixonados. Com a ascensão de plataformas como o SteamOS e a chegada de soluções convergentes como o Steam Deck, o acesso a títulos icônicos como World of Warcraft e Starcraft está se tornando mais fluido, apesar da ausência de uma versão nativa do Battle.net para Linux. Este guia de instruções detalha métodos confiáveis para instalar o Battle.net no Linux, especialmente no SteamOS e no Steam Deck, usando ferramentas adequadas como Lutris ou Proton. Ele é voltado tanto para iniciantes quanto para administradores de sistema que desejam otimizar a experiência de jogo por meio de camadas de compatibilidade robustas.

Instalando o Battle.net no Linux com o Lutris: Simplicidade e Eficiência para Jogadores

Iniciar o Battle.net no Linux requer uma camada de compatibilidade, já que a Blizzard não oferece um instalador nativo para distribuições GNU/Linux. O Lutris, uma plataforma de gerenciamento de jogos de código aberto especializada na integração de aplicativos Windows no Linux, geralmente representa a solução mais prática. O Lutris utiliza o Wine

, uma camada de compatibilidade capaz de traduzir chamadas do Windows em instruções compreensíveis por um sistema Linux. Distribuir o Lutris via Flatpak simplifica sua instalação na maioria das distribuições populares, incluindo SteamOS e Steam Deck. Os seguintes comandos são suficientes para instalá-lo em uma distribuição baseada em Debian ou Fedora: flatpak install flathub net.lutris.LutrisOu use o gerenciador de pacotes nativo, dependendo da distribuição (Apt, Dnf, Pacman).

  • Após a instalação, o Lutris oferece um sistema fácil para importar jogos de scripts da comunidade. Para o Battle.net, basta procurar o inicializador na biblioteca do Lutris, executar o script de instalação e seguir as instruções automatizadas. O script gerencia a configuração do Wine, baixa o inicializador oficial e prepara o ambiente de execução. Um ponto crucial a ser observado é nunca efetuar login diretamente na sua conta do Battle.net ao executar o instalador pela primeira vez. Isso permite que o Lutris finalize a configuração interna sem causar erros relacionados à manipulação do banco de dados no Wine. Os pontos fortes do Lutris incluem:
  • Automação de etapas frequentemente complexas no Wine

Gerenciamento simplificado de diferentes versões do Wine para otimizar a compatibilidade Capacidade de instalar pré-requisitos necessários, como bibliotecas redistribuíveis do DirectX ou Visual C++, por meio de scripts integradosInteração suave com o SteamOS e o Steam Deck graças a uma interface gráfica ergonômica

Problemas comuns, como travamentos do inicializador ou lentidão no carregamento, geralmente podem ser resolvidos com a documentação ativa do Lutris no GitHub. Este recurso também lista comentários de usuários e correções temporárias, o que é essencial porque o Battle.net mantém um histórico de compatibilidade flutuante com o Wine. Além de gerenciar o instalador, a Lutris facilita a manutenção dos pré-requisitos para iniciar World of Warcraft e Starcraft no Linux, permitindo uma experiência quase nativa.

  • Confira nosso guia completo sobre como usar o Battle.net no Linux. Aprenda a instalar, configurar e otimizar sua experiência de jogo nesta plataforma essencial, com dicas e soluções para problemas comuns.
  • Usando o Steam para Integrar o Battle.net e Gerenciar o Runtime via Proton
  • Outra abordagem útil é instalar o Battle.net diretamente pelo cliente Steam, aproveitando a camada de compatibilidade do Proton. O Proton é uma adaptação modificada do Wine desenvolvida pela Valve que facilita a execução nativa de jogos para Windows no SteamOS e no Steam Deck.
  • Este método tem duas vantagens principais:

Integração total com a biblioteca do Steam, simplificando o lançamento e o gerenciamento de jogos da Blizzard Acesso automatizado às últimas melhorias feitas no Proton, frequentemente otimizadas para o Steam DeckPara prosseguir, aqui está um passo a passo técnico detalhado:

Baixe o instalador do Battle.net do site oficial da Blizzard. O arquivo está localizado por padrão em ~/Downloads.

Abra o Steam e, no canto inferior esquerdo: Adicione um jogo e escolha Adicionar um jogo que não seja do Steam.

Clique em Procurar para selecionar o arquivo Battle.net-setup.exe e adicioná-lo à biblioteca. Em seguida, clique com o botão direito do mouse nesta entrada, selecione Propriedades e navegue até Compatibilidade. Marque a caixa de seleção “Forçar o uso de uma ferramenta de compatibilidade” e escolha uma versão recente do Proton (de preferência, Proton 9 ou posterior). Inicie o programa para instalar o Battle.net. Após a conclusão, a primeira execução solicitará que você altere o atalho para que ele aponte para o inicializador real, não para o instalador.Para fazer isso, navegue até o diretório oculto do Steam onde o Proton armazena os programas instalados, calcule o número de ID mais recente em ~/.steam/steam/steamapps/compatdata/ e, em seguida, ajuste manualmente o caminho nas propriedades do jogo para Battle.net Launcher.exe. Este método, embora mais técnico, fornece um ambiente estável para títulos como World of Warcraft e Starcraft.Dominar a configuração manual de caminhos é essencial, pois o Steam nunca atualiza automaticamente o atalho para jogos instalados por meio de um instalador externo.

Em um ambiente Linux, a etiqueta de rede para gerenciar diretórios ocultos é essencial. No KDE Plasma, como em outros ambientes, é possível exibir essas pastas via Ctrl+H, facilitando a navegação e ajustando os prefixos do Proton. A diversidade de distribuições GNU/Linux frequentemente exige a adaptação de caminhos, daí a importância de entender a estrutura em árvore do Steam e do Proton.

  • Prós do Steam + Proton: gerenciamento de atualizações simplificado, acesso rápido a partir da Biblioteca do Steam
  • Contras: a configuração manual pode ser complicada, menos automação do que o Lutris

Descubra nosso guia completo sobre como usar o battle.net no Linux. Siga etapas simples para instalar e configurar a plataforma e aproveite seus jogos favoritos em um ambiente Linux. Configurando o Steam Deck e o SteamOS para uma experiência de jogo ideal com a Blizzard

  1. O Steam Decké um console híbrido para PC que executa o SteamOS, uma distribuição Linux otimizada para jogos. Tornar o inicializador do Battle.net compatível com este hardware requer alguma preparação, principalmente porque o SteamOS usa um kernel Linux recente com uma arquitetura específica.
  2. Várias etapas são necessárias para minimizar incompatibilidades e maximizar a fluidez: Habilite o Modo Desktop para lidar com os instaladores com mais facilidade com uma interface completa do navegador web. Instale as dependências necessárias por meio do gerenciador de pacotes ou Flatpak, especialmente Lutris e Wine, se preferir esse caminho.Configure o Proton no Steam para o método direto, certificando-se de manter a versão do Proton atualizada, que frequentemente fornece patches para jogos do Windows.
  3. Considere instalar plugins Linux especializados para otimizar a renderização e o desempenho, conforme descrito neste guia de plugins para Linux. Gerencie adequadamente o gerenciamento de energia e temperatura do Steam Deck durante sessões prolongadas para evitar quedas inesperadas de desempenho.
  4. Além disso, o uso do Steam Deck frequentemente requer o uso de um teclado e mouse “externos” para facilitar a navegação durante a instalação. A tela sensível ao toque e os controles nativos do Steam Deck são ideais para jogos, mas podem tornar a configuração inicial de ambientes Windows via Proton ou Wine tediosa. O Steam Deck se beneficia do poder de um kernel Linux moderno e de amplo suporte a hardware, mas sua otimização também requer monitoramento da versão do kernel, conforme descrito neste guia do kernel Linux 6.12 LTS. Esse monitoramento garante suporte de hardware ideal para renderização gráfica e gerenciamento de dispositivos USB, essenciais para jogos de alto desempenho. Confira nosso guia completo para usar o battle.net no Linux. Aprenda como instalar e configurar a plataforma de jogos, otimizar seu desempenho e aproveitar seus jogos favoritos em seu sistema Linux.Exemplos e dicas práticas para evitar armadilhas comuns de instalação Além das principais etapas técnicas, é útil conhecer os erros comuns e como antecipá-los para instalar o Battle.net com sucesso no ecossistema Linux. O procedimento não é uma simples instalação de software para Windows, pois as interações entre as diferentes camadas devem ser levadas em consideração. Erro comum: Conectar-se ao Battle.net antes da instalação do Lutris. Isso bloqueia a configuração e pode exigir uma reinstalação completa. Solução:
  5. Siga sempre as instruções do script do Lutris completamente e tente abrir o Battle.net pela primeira vez algumas horas depois, caso ocorra uma falha.
  6. Problemas de permissão: No Linux, às vezes são necessários direitos de root para instalar certas dependências. Tenha cuidado para não executar o Lutris ou o Steam como root.Pasta oculta do Proton: Não exclua perfis em~/.steam/steam/steamapps/compatdata/

ou você corre o risco de perder suas configurações. Versão incorreta do Proton: Uma versão mais antiga pode impedir a instalação ou causar falhas. Recomendação: Use a versão estável mais recente disponível. Problemas de configuração do inicializador:Modificar atalhos no Steam para apontar para o executável Battle.net Launcher.exe é essencial.

Além dessas dicas, a colaboração com a comunidade de jogos Linux é essencial. Fóruns como o LinuxEnCaja fornecem feedback valioso e scripts atualizados que podem ajudar a automatizar algumas tarefas tediosas. https://www.youtube.com/watch?v=syEpGEzI_UQ Perspectivas e Possíveis Evoluções do Ecossistema de Jogos Linux com Battle.net, Steam Deck e SteamOS Embora o ecossistema de jogos Linux esteja crescendo rapidamente em 2025, as soluções de integração para plataformas proprietárias como o Battle.net continuarão a exigir ajustes de compatibilidade. A falta de um cliente nativo do Battle.net está levando a comunidade a desenvolver ferramentas e scripts para automatizar a instalação e a manutenção.A ascensão das camadas Proton e Wine, com o apoio da Valve e da comunidade de código aberto, abre caminho para uma experiência mais fluida para jogadores Linux. O Proton se beneficia de melhorias frequentes para otimizar o gerenciamento de GPU, multithreading e APIs gráficas como a Vulkan. Esses avanços estão colocando o Linux de volta ao centro das plataformas de videogame, principalmente graças ao sucesso do Steam Deck. Considerando esses avanços, aqui estão as principais áreas que podem transformar a experiência do usuário:

  • Integração mais profunda
  • do Battle.net com as bibliotecas do Steam por meio de scripts inteligentes
Desenvolvimento de um cliente Battle.net de código aberto

baseado nas APIs da Blizzard para limitar a dependência do Wine

Melhorias de desempenho reduzindo a latência e os bugs relacionados à camada de compatibilidade Suporte aprimorado para distribuições de jogos Linux

por meio de plugins e ferramentas especializados (consulte Plugins Linux)

  • Finalmente, a ampla disponibilidade de ferramentas de inicialização múltipla USB, capazes de instalar múltiplas distribuições Linux em uma única máquina, facilitará os testes e a implantação de ambientes de jogos dedicados, conforme explicado neste guia para soluções de inicialização múltipla USB para Linux
  • . Isso deve incentivar mais usuários a adotarem a ideia.
  • https://www.youtube.com/watch?v=qs0ULJIz_Rg